中国人工智能学会通讯——个性化推荐和资源分配在金融和经济中的应用 1.2 智能金融·个性化推荐

简介:

1.2 智能金融·个性化推荐

第一类是关于个性化推荐的情况。我们刚才已经看到过的,有理财产品或者是金融类新闻的每天推送的情况。我们知道,对于不同的用户来说,可能关注点是不一样的,甚至有时用户自己都不知道,自己的风险承受能力怎样,自己到底希望要一个怎样的预期年化收益率。但是我们依然希望通过观察用户的点击历史,慢慢地学到用户潜在的一些特性参数。这是一个(像刚才梦迪提到的)增强学习的过程,其中需要处理所谓的Exploration Exploitation Tradeoff:要在推荐一些确定知道适合该用户的,以及推荐一些相对未知但可能更适合一些新的(理财产品)这两者之间找到恰当的平衡。

再有一些其他的场景,比如说金融类的新闻推荐的时候就会遇到一些更麻烦的问题。新闻由于其本身的特性,更新得特别快,推送一个过时的新闻是没有意义的。另外在移动端,推荐显示的一般是一个新闻列表,这样就会有一个反馈非常少的问题。比如说我第1屏推20个,不是这20个所有的反馈我都能拿到。我可能看到的是用户点击了第2个、第6个,但是第6个之后发生了什么事情就完全不知道了,可能第7、8个新闻用户看了标题不感兴趣所以就没点,也可能看完第6个就关掉app了,第7、8个根本连标题都没有看。这种对列表的推荐和反馈信息会跟以前传统的情景很不一样。

有一类办法能够一定程度上解决这种冷启动(cold start),或者是目标的变化非常迅速的情况,就是用强化学习里Contextual Multi-Armed Bandit的算法。我们去年做的一个结果是,如果你做T次这样的推荐,平均来看,每一次你离最优解的只相差1/T;也就是说在对用户隐藏参数和未来信息都不确定的情况下,我们的算法仍然会非常接近于最优推荐。

image

稍微讲一点这里的细节。我们这里的模型是说,假设你有一个可以执行的Action的集合,在每一轮时这个Action的集合可以比如根据来的用户不同而不一样。这个Action就是一个你要推荐的有序列表(ordered list)。当用户看到这个列表以后,就会从前往下一个一个去检查,然后会在一个地方停止了,而不再检查后面的项目。这里并不知道在哪里停止了,我们能拿到的反馈只是用户在哪里点击过了。

image

有时在其他场景中有不只点击的反馈,比如App推荐,你会看到用户下载行为;电商的产品推荐,你会看到用户购买行为;不一样的场景会有不同的反馈。但是无论那种反馈,我们看到以后需要根据这些信息,来决定下一步怎样做。我们用后悔度(Regret)来衡量算法的有效性:在整个的T轮推荐里面,我们算法的行为,和如果我们知道所以隐含参数的情况下应该选择的最优行为之间的差别。我们没有办法展开很多的细节,只能说我们的结果是在T轮中,我们的Regret可以控制在T这么大。后来,我们又进行了一系列的延伸,能够处理多个点击的情况,非线性点击率期望的情况和结合用户间相似度的方法等。

相关文章
|
10天前
|
机器学习/深度学习 人工智能 自然语言处理
AI技术深度解析:从基础到应用的全面介绍
人工智能(AI)技术的迅猛发展,正在深刻改变着我们的生活和工作方式。从自然语言处理(NLP)到机器学习,从神经网络到大型语言模型(LLM),AI技术的每一次进步都带来了前所未有的机遇和挑战。本文将从背景、历史、业务场景、Python代码示例、流程图以及如何上手等多个方面,对AI技术中的关键组件进行深度解析,为读者呈现一个全面而深入的AI技术世界。
66 10
|
3天前
|
机器学习/深度学习 人工智能 物联网
AI赋能大学计划·大模型技术与应用实战学生训练营——湖南大学站圆满结营
12月14日,由中国软件行业校园招聘与实习公共服务平台携手魔搭社区共同举办的AI赋能大学计划·大模型技术与产业趋势高校行AIGC项目实战营·湖南大学站圆满结营。
AI赋能大学计划·大模型技术与应用实战学生训练营——湖南大学站圆满结营
|
14天前
|
机器学习/深度学习 人工智能 自然语言处理
转载:【AI系统】AI的领域、场景与行业应用
本文概述了AI的历史、现状及发展趋势,探讨了AI在计算机视觉、自然语言处理、语音识别等领域的应用,以及在金融、医疗、教育、互联网等行业中的实践案例。随着技术进步,AI模型正从单一走向多样化,从小规模到大规模分布式训练,企业级AI系统设计面临更多挑战,同时也带来了新的研究与工程实践机遇。文中强调了AI基础设施的重要性,并鼓励读者深入了解AI系统的设计原则与研究方法,共同推动AI技术的发展。
转载:【AI系统】AI的领域、场景与行业应用
|
9天前
|
机器学习/深度学习 人工智能 算法
探索AI在医疗诊断中的应用与挑战
【10月更文挑战第21天】 本文深入探讨了人工智能(AI)技术在医疗诊断领域的应用现状与面临的挑战,旨在为读者提供一个全面的视角,了解AI如何改变传统医疗模式,以及这一变革过程中所伴随的技术、伦理和法律问题。通过分析AI技术的优势和局限性,本文旨在促进对AI在医疗领域应用的更深层次理解和讨论。
|
15天前
|
人工智能 缓存 异构计算
云原生AI加速生成式人工智能应用的部署构建
本文探讨了云原生技术背景下,尤其是Kubernetes和容器技术的发展,对模型推理服务带来的挑战与优化策略。文中详细介绍了Knative的弹性扩展机制,包括HPA和CronHPA,以及针对传统弹性扩展“滞后”问题提出的AHPA(高级弹性预测)。此外,文章重点介绍了Fluid项目,它通过分布式缓存优化了模型加载的I/O操作,显著缩短了推理服务的冷启动时间,特别是在处理大规模并发请求时表现出色。通过实际案例,展示了Fluid在vLLM和Qwen模型推理中的应用效果,证明了其在提高模型推理效率和响应速度方面的优势。
云原生AI加速生成式人工智能应用的部署构建
|
6天前
|
机器学习/深度学习 人工智能 自然语言处理
AI在自然语言处理中的突破:从理论到应用
AI在自然语言处理中的突破:从理论到应用
50 17
|
6天前
|
人工智能 Serverless API
尽享红利,Serverless构建企业AI应用方案与实践
本次课程由阿里云云原生架构师计缘分享,主题为“尽享红利,Serverless构建企业AI应用方案与实践”。课程分为四个部分:1) Serverless技术价值,介绍其发展趋势及优势;2) Serverless函数计算与AI的结合,探讨两者融合的应用场景;3) Serverless函数计算AIGC应用方案,展示具体的技术实现和客户案例;4) 业务初期如何降低使用门槛,提供新用户权益和免费资源。通过这些内容,帮助企业和开发者快速构建高效、低成本的AI应用。
44 12
|
3天前
|
人工智能 容灾 关系型数据库
【AI应用启航workshop】构建高可用数据库、拥抱AI智能问数
12月25日(周三)14:00-16:30参与线上闭门会,阿里云诚邀您一同开启AI应用实践之旅!
|
10天前
|
数据采集 人工智能 移动开发
盘点人工智能在医疗诊断领域的应用
人工智能在医疗诊断领域的应用广泛,包括医学影像诊断、疾病预测与风险评估、病理诊断、药物研发、医疗机器人、远程医疗诊断和智能辅助诊断系统等。这些应用提高了诊断的准确性和效率,改善了患者的治疗效果和生活质量。然而,数据质量和安全性、AI系统的透明度等问题仍需关注和解决。
129 10
|
2天前
|
人工智能 前端开发 Java
Spring AI Alibaba + 通义千问,开发AI应用如此简单!!!
本文介绍了如何使用Spring AI Alibaba开发一个简单的AI对话应用。通过引入`spring-ai-alibaba-starter`依赖和配置API密钥,结合Spring Boot项目,只需几行代码即可实现与AI模型的交互。具体步骤包括创建Spring Boot项目、编写Controller处理对话请求以及前端页面展示对话内容。此外,文章还介绍了如何通过添加对话记忆功能,使AI能够理解上下文并进行连贯对话。最后,总结了Spring AI为Java开发者带来的便利,简化了AI应用的开发流程。
76 0